Abstract: | The potentials of Pt-black electrode using a copper conducting wire instead of the salt bridge in acid and alkaline solutions without the use of H2 evolution reactions were measured. There were three nonlinear portions in the calibration curve. Unusually, the potential slopes at pH 3-5 and 8-10 indicated 200 mV and 70 mV per pH, respectively.
